How it works

What runs inside

Aggregated data decays the moment a feed breaks or a balance goes stale, and keeping it clean is quiet, constant work. The agent does that maintenance continuously, so the data flowing into planning and reporting can actually be trusted.

01

Connect

Establishes and holds connections to each client's institutions, custodial feeds and held-away accounts alike, through direct data connections wherever they exist.

Reaches the accounts
02

Normalize

Turns inconsistent data from thousands of institutions into one clean, consistent format, so downstream systems receive numbers they can rely on.

Cleans the data
03

Feed Watch

Watches every connection for the breaks, stale balances, and format changes that silently corrupt an aggregated view, and catches them before they reach a client report.

Catches the breaks
04

Reconnect

Attempts to restore broken feeds automatically and, when a client re-authentication is needed, prepares the request for the adviser to send.

Restores the flow
05

Distribute

Pushes the clean, current data into the CRM, planning, and reporting tools that depend on it, so the same numbers appear everywhere at once.

Feeds the stack

How is it different from a data aggregation feed like Yodlee or ByAllAccounts?

Those provide the raw connections; the agent manages them. It watches every feed for breaks and stale balances, restores connections, normalizes the data, and pushes it downstream, closing the gap a raw aggregation feed leaves between the data arriving and it being usable.

Does it use client login credentials?

It uses direct data connections wherever they exist, and where a client must re-authenticate, it prepares the request rather than storing logins. That keeps the firm clear of the custody and cybersecurity exposure that credential-sharing creates.

What happens when a feed breaks?

The agent catches it and flags it rather than passing bad data downstream. It attempts to reconnect automatically, and when a client re-authentication is needed, it prepares the request for the adviser. No report quietly shows a balance that stopped updating days ago.
